Web27 de jul. de 2024 · Naturalistic observation is an observational method that involves observing people’s behavior in the environment in which it typically occurs. Thus naturalistic observation is a type of field research (as opposed to a type of laboratory research). WebIn many scientific disciplines, naturalistic observation is a useful tool for expanding knowledge about a specific phenomenon or species. In fields such as anthropology, behavioral biology and ecology, watching a person or organism in a natural environment is essential.
